A Flexible Printed Circuit (FPC) are often used in electronics devices. It is made on a thin elastic film which is bent in the devices and mounted on circuit boards. In this paper, a system to estimate the 3D bending shape of the FPCs is proposed. A 3D path of the central curve of the FPC is first designed to connect the end connectors and then its surface is generated from this cure and the 2D diagram of the FPC. We propose a method based on rectifying developable surfaces to generate the surface. A new method for preserving the curve length is also described. A prototype software is developed to demonstrate some simple design examples.
